Review of the 2012 Suzuki SX4 Sedan
Introduction
The Suzuki SX4 sedan is a good choice among small cars for those looking for something other than just the cheapest, most basic transportation. It is backed by America's #1 Warranty: 100,000-miles/seven-year, fully transferable, zero-deductible powertrain limited warranty. The SX4 sedan comes in base, LE and LE Popular trims.
Exterior Design and Special Features
The base SX4 sedan rolls on 15-inch steel wheels with full power accessories, a height-adjustable driver seat, a tilt steering wheel and a 60/40-split-folding rear seat. Daytime running lights and intermittent windshield wipers are standard on all trims.
The LE gets air-conditioning and a four-speaker sound system with a CD player and an auxiliary audio jack. A 4-speaker AM / FM / CD audio system with MP3 playback, and speed-sensing volume control is standard on LE and LE Popular. Remote keyless entry is optional on both.
The LE Popular package comes with cruise control and a leather-wrapped steering wheel with audio controls.
Engine
The SX4 base sedan and LE are powered by a 2.0L DOHC 16-valve I4 engine rated at 150 HP and 140 lb-ft torque. It is mated to a 6-speed manual transmission.
Safety
Four-wheel anti-lock braking system (ABS) with electronic brake-force distribution (EBD); advanced, dual-stage driver and weight- sensing, front- passenger airbags; supplemental restraint system (SRS); front seat-mounted side impact airbags; front and rear side-curtain airbags; rear child-seat LATCH system (lower anchors and tethers for children); rear-door child safety locks; front ventilated four-wheel disc brakes and t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) are standard across all trims.
